Before posting, each Tripadvisor review goes through an automated tracking system, which collects information, answering the following questions: how, what, where and when. If the system detects something that potentially contradicts our community guidelines, the review is not published.
When the system detects a problem, a review may be automatically rejected, sent to the reviewer for validation, or manually reviewed by our team of content specialists, who work 24/7 to maintain the quality of the reviews on our site.
Our team checks each review posted on the site disputed by our community as not meeting our community guidelines.

We last visited Westward in 2010 and were so pleased to find that standards were as high as before. The location has very good views over the hills above Thames and being a good distance off of the road it is very quiet and very restful. The accommodation is tastefully furnished, well laid out, spacious and exceeding clean. Wonderful decorative effects by Linda made the bedroom feel really special and the kingsize bed was extremely comfortable. The ensuite, likewise was a good size with a good supply of accessories such as soaps, skin lotions etc. We had pre-booked dinner for the first night and were rewarded by an excellent meal - the lamb was really succulent. We had a most enjoyable stroll around the gardens with Linda, Ian and their dogs. Breakfasts on both mornings were of a very high standard. We would thoroughly recommend this establishment and would go out of our way to revisit. Thanks Linda & Ian for a wonderful return visit.

Westwinds is set in a lovely rural area with fantastic views from the property. You will be given detailed instructions as to how to find the place and they work beautifully. Ian and Linda are welcoming and friendly and are justifiably proud of the lovely home they have created. Make sure you have a good book to curl up with, stretched out on the sofa on their raised deck, with a glass of wine at hand! There are two guest rooms in total. The bedroom we had was very attractive with an ensuite and its own outside sitting area. With one other set of guests and a travel cot full of new puppies, our time there was very relaxed and sociable. We enjoyed Ian's pancakes and I have successfully tried the recipe at home!

We spend 1 night at Westwind and had such a great time! Linda & Ian are wonderful hosts, they really make you feel confortable. The place is lovely, in the middle of nature, great view from the veranda. We enjoiyed a lot our chat with our hosts & the tour oft eh property. There are quite some animals oft he farm, so that’s great: pings, dogs, cats. We had dinner with our hosts, and it was delicious! Weh ad great lamb and vegetables. The rooms are wonderful and with caracter. The cats can go all over the place, so clsoe the door if you are allergic, and take an antihistaminic staff. We are allergic, but this did not change anything to the great moments we had there. We enjoyed the breakfast. Our hosts had to goto work very early, but let everything for us when we woke up. Weh ad plenty of juices, yogourts, cereals. Our hosts helped us with our sightseeing plans in the area, suggesting usseveral places to go for our day to Rotorua. Weh ad such a great farm experience, and we felt so welcomed, that we loved the place!
